Transaction 2663c887ac3ad3eaaf49578d50ba67d5a3822e3749c6a8a619aa92fdd0b91d98
1 Input
1 Output
-
2663c887ac3ad3eaaf49578d50ba67d5a3822e3749c6a8a619aa92fdd0b91d98:0
- value
- 24926412
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ad72ceaf22264026450ec8cc4ddf3f1ce2e6f11 OP_EQUAL
- address
- 3FojkjoF6FWLhhhmeQm4LfxdniXpkr53sP